Rainfall threshold to trigger landslides in unsaturated soils: A laboratory model study
Ahmadi-adli, Mohammad; Huvaj Sarıhan, Nejan; Toker, Nabi Kartal (2017-09-22)
Rainfall triggered landslides are common natural hazards with significant consequences all over the world. In this study, laboratory model tests are conducted which aims to obtain the rainfall intensity-duration threshold to trigger landslides in a slope composed of unsaturated soil in a flume setup. Sixteen laboratory model tests are conducted to obtain the rainfall intensityduration threshold. Rainfall-triggered landslides in an unsaturated soil: a laboratory flume study
Ahmadi-Adli, Mohammad; Huvaj Sarıhan, Nejan; Toker, Nabi Kartal (2017-11-01)
Extreme and/or prolonged rainfall events frequently cause landslides in many parts of the world. In this study, infiltration of rainfall into an unsaturated soil slope and triggering of landslides is studied through laboratory model (flume) tests, with the goal of obtaining the triggering rainfall intensity-duration (I-D) threshold.
